When they upgrade the PhoneWave (not phone microwave) by ripping its door off, they also mention that they bought a burner phone exclusively for it, and Daru wrote a program that redirects the message to whoever they want. So they just need to send the message to the PhoneWave's cellphone and it will redirect it to any address they want, be it Luka's mom's pager or Faris' dad's phone.
